How to increment a column value with an increasing number in a csv file - awk

I have a text file with 3 columns as below.
$ cat test.txt
1,A,300
1,B,300
1,C,300
Till now i have tried as, awk -F, '{$3=$3+1;print}' OFS=, test.txt
But output is coming as:
1,A,301
1,B,301
1,C,301
& below is my desired output
Now i want to increment the third column only, the output should be like below
1,A,300
1,B,301
1,C,302
How can I achieve the desired output?

could be, assuming line are sequential like your sample)
awk -F ',' '{sub($3"$",$3+NR-1)}7' YourFile
it use the line numer as increment value, changing the line end and not the field value (different from an awk POV, that don't need to rebuild the line with separator)
Alternative if empty or other line between modifiable lines (i arbitrary use NF as filter but it depend of your criteria if any)
awk -F ',' 'NF{sub($3"$",$3+i++)}7' YourFile

awk 'BEGIN{x=0;FS=OFS=","} NF>1{$3=$3+x;x++}1' inputfile
1,A,300
1,B,301
1,C,302
Explanation:
BEGIN Block : It contains x which is a counter initially set to zero, FS and OFS . /./ is used to ignore blank lines(Remove this part if there are no blank lines). $3=$3+x : This will add the value of counter to $3. x++ : To increment the current value of the counter.

try this NR starts at 1 so NR -1 should give you the correct number
awk -F, '{$3=$3+NR-1;print}' OFS=, test.txt

I would harness GNU AWK for this task following way, let file.txt content be
f1,f2,f3,f4,f5,test
row1_1,row1_2,row1_3,SBCDE,row1_5,SBCD
row2_1,row2_2,row2_3,AWERF,row2_5,AWER
row3_1,row3_2,row3_3,ASDFG,row3_5,ASDF
row4_1,row4_2,row4_3,PRE-ASDQG,row4_5,ASDQ
row4_1,row4_2,row4_3,PRE-ASDQF,row4_5,ASDQ
then
awk 'BEGIN{FS=OFS=","}NR==1{print $0,"count";next}FNR==NR{arr[$6]+=1;next}FNR>1{print $0,arr[$6]}' file.txt file.txt
gives output
f1,f2,f3,f4,f5,test,count
row1_1,row1_2,row1_3,SBCDE,row1_5,SBCD,1
row2_1,row2_2,row2_3,AWERF,row2_5,AWER,1
row3_1,row3_2,row3_3,ASDFG,row3_5,ASDF,1
row4_1,row4_2,row4_3,PRE-ASDQG,row4_5,ASDQ,2
row4_1,row4_2,row4_3,PRE-ASDQF,row4_5,ASDQ,2
Explanation: this is two-pass approach, hence file.txt appears twice. I inform GNU AWK that , is both field separator (FS) and output field separator (OFS), then for first line (header) I print it followed by count and instruct GNU AWK to go to next line, so nothing other is done regarding 1st line, then for first pass, i.e. where global number of line (NR) is equal to number of line in file (FNR) I count number of occurences of values in 6th field and store them as values in array arr, then instruct GNU AWK to get to next line, so onthing other is done in this pass. During second pass for all lines after 1st (FNR>1) I print whole line ($0) followed by corresponding value from array arr
(tested in GNU Awk 5.0.1)

Replace number in a template file with numbers from a list and output to different files

file1.txt is like:
$view->name = '12483291';
...
$view->human_name = '12483291';
Also I have some numbers in file2:
8789
53416
673425
What I need to do is: for each number in the above column, replace the '12483291' value, and create a new file named after the replacement number.
Desired output:
file: 8789.inc
$view->name = '8789'
...
$view->human_name = '8789'
file: 53416.inc
$view->name = '53416'
...
$view->human_name = '53416'
file: 673425.inc
$view->name = '673425'
...
$view->human_name = '673425'
How would you approach this?
A few of my attempts, but without getting the result I want:
sed "s/12483291/$(cat file2)/" file1 > 8789.inc
The above works if file2 has only one line, and I have to run the command as many times as the values in file2, manually giving the name of the result file.
This might work for you (GNU sed):
sed -n 's/.*/sed "s#12483291#&#g" file1 >&.inc/e' file2
Replace the number 1248329 in the template file1 by each number in file2 and name the file produced by that number with .inc appended.
If your file has dos-style line ending, see Why does my tool output overwrite itself and how do I fix it? first.
With GNU awk
awk -v q="'" -v s="'12483291'" 'NR==FNR{a[$1]; next}
{for(k in a) {print gensub(s, q k q, 1) > k".inc"}}' f2 f1
-v q="'" just a handy variable with single quote character
-v s="'12483291'" the field value to be replaced
NR==FNR{a[$1]; next} here NR has overall record number and FNR has current file record number. So, NR==FNR will be true only for first file. The array a will store the first field as keys.
for(k in a) for the second file, loop over all the keys in array a
gensub(s, q k q, 1) change the field value with value of the key (note that this will replace only first match and assumes s doesn't have any regex metacharacter)
output of gensub is then redirected to a filename based on the key
Add -v RS='\r\n' to handle dos-style input
With other awk you may run into too many files issue if f2 has large number of lines. Change the loop content to {line=$0; sub(s, q k q, line); f=k".inc"; print line >> f; close(f)}. This assumes .inc files don't already exist, otherwise, you'll get content appended.

In this simple case where the last field has to be removed and placed on the last line, you can do
awk -F , -v OFS=, '{ x = $6; NF = 5; print; $5 = x; print }'
Here -F , and -v OFS=, will set the input and output field separators to a comma, respectively, and the code does
{
x = $6 # remember sixth field
NF = 5 # Set field number to 5, so the last one won't be printed
print # print those first five fields
$5 = x # replace value of fifth field with remembered value of sixth
print # print modified line
}
This approach can be extended to handle fields in the middle with a function like the one in the accepted answer of this question.
EDIT: As Ed notes in the comments, writing to NF is not explicitly defined to trigger a rebuild of $0 (the whole-line record that print prints) in the POSIX standard. The above code works with GNU awk and mawk, but with BSD awk (as found on *BSD and probably Mac OS X) it fails to do anything.
So to be standards-compliant, we have to be a little more explicit and force awk to rebuild $0 from the modified field state. This can be done by assigning to any of the field variables $1...$NF, and it's common to use $1=$1 when this problem pops up in other contexts (for example: when only the field separator needs to be changed but not any of the data):
awk -F , -v OFS=, '{ x = $6; NF = 5; $1 = $1; print; $5 = x; print }'
I've tested this with GNU awk, mawk and BSD awk (which are all the awks I can lay my hands on), and I believe this to be covered by the awk bit in POSIX where it says "setting any other field causes the re-evaluation of $0" right at the top. Mind you, the spec could be more explicit on this point, and I'd be interested to test if more exotic awks behave the same way.

Print every nth column of a file

I have a rather big file with 255 coma separated columns and I need to print out every third column only.
I was trying something like this
awk '{ for (i=0;i<=NF;i+=3) print $i }' file
but that doesn't seem to be the solution, since it prints to only one long column. Anybody can help? Thanks
Here is one way to do this.
The script prog.awk:
BEGIN {FS = ","} # field separator
{for (i = 1; i <= NF; i += 3) printf ("%s%c", $i, i + 3 <= NF ? "," : "\n");}
Invocation:
awk -f prog.awk <input.csv >output.csv
Example input.csv:
1,2,3,4,5,6,7,8,9,10
11,12,13,14,15,16,17,18,19,20
Example output.csv:
1,4,7,10
11,14,17,20
It behaves like that because by default awk splits fields in spaces. You have to tell it to split them with commas, and it's done using the FS variable or the -F switch. Besides that, first field is number one. The zero is the whole line, so also change the initial value of the for loop:
awk -F',' '{ for (i=1;i<=NF;i+=3) print $i }' file
